This issue of the DRN, which is the final issue of the revamped DRN for 2013, chronicles the proceedings of the nationwide celebration of the 11th Development Policy ²ÝÝ®ÊÓÆµ Month (DPRM) last September. With the theme "Making health more inclusive in a growing economy", the DPRM events highlighted policies aimed at making health more inclusive. An important recommendation is for the Philippines to hike health expenditures to the minimum 5 percent recommended by the World Health Organization from the current 3 to 3.5 percent.
Other DPRM-related articles feature effective tools for evaluation of the impact of antipoverty and development projects, best practices in health financing and innovations, the government`s Universal Health Care program, inequalities in maternal health and child care, and public-private partnership arrangements in health.
